Abstract

The utility model provides a garage door and belt connecting buckle, belongs to the technical field of connecting parts, and aims to solve the problem of complex connecting operation of a traditional garage door and a belt, and comprises a buckle piece; the front side of the clamping piece is provided with a barb, the inside of the clamping piece and the inside of the tail end of the barb are fixedly provided with connecting rods, and the left side of the clamping piece is hooked with a hook at the top end of the garage door; front clamping blocks at the upper end and the lower end of the connecting rod; the fixing plate is fixedly inserted into the front side of the buckle piece; the push plate is movably clamped on the rear side of the fixed plate and the front side of the clamping piece; the clamping rod is longitudinally inserted into the clamping piece. The belt buckle is provided with the buckle, when the buckle is singly used for carrying out buckle connection on the belt, the belt buckle can be locked with the belt through the barbs, after the belt is driven to rotate by the driving shaft, the belt drives the buckle to move, and then the clamping hook is pulled to drive the garage door to lift and open, so that the configuration can be simplified, the cost is reduced, and meanwhile, the operation is simplified.

Garage door and belt connecting buckle
Technical Field
The utility model belongs to the technical field of connecting parts, and particularly relates to a garage door and belt connecting buckle.
Background
The garage door is a common facility for enterprises, is suitable for public places or houses such as business gate surfaces, garages, markets, hospitals and the like, and is particularly positioned at a position where the ground gate body is inconvenient to install and the gate opening is large, and the garage door plays a role in conveniently and rapidly opening.
The existing garage door is generally divided into a manual garage door and an automatic garage door, and the manual garage door is troublesome to open and close and is easy to damage, so that the automatic garage door is mostly used at present, but the automatic garage door and a track motor are connected with a belt by adopting a clip method, and the belt is required to be detached from the clip for replacement when the automatic garage door is replaced, so that the problems of larger belt stress, complex operation and low working efficiency exist.
Disclosure of Invention
In order to solve the technical problems, the utility model provides a garage door and belt connecting buckle to solve the problems of larger belt stress, complex operation and low working efficiency in the traditional connecting mode.
The aim and the effect of the connecting buckle of the garage door and the belt are achieved by the following specific technical means:
the garage door and the belt connecting buckle comprise a mounting main body, a buckle piece, a fixed plate, a push plate, a clamping rod and a clamping hook; the mounting main body is fixedly mounted on the garage roof, a belt is mounted in the mounting main body, a motor box is clamped at the bottom of the mounting main body, a driving motor is mounted in the motor box, and a driving shaft of the driving motor is coaxially connected to the belt; the front side of the clamping piece is provided with a barb, the inside of the clamping piece and the inside of the tail end of the barb are fixedly provided with connecting rods, and the left side of the clamping piece is hooked with a hook at the top end of the garage door; front clamping blocks at the upper end and the lower end of the connecting rod; the fixing plate is fixedly inserted into the front side of the buckle piece; the push plate is movably clamped on the rear side of the fixed plate and the front side of the clamping piece; the clamping rod is longitudinally inserted into the clamping piece.

Detailed Description
Embodiments of the present utility model are described in further detail below with reference to the accompanying drawings and examples.
Examples:
as shown in fig. 1 to 6:
the utility model provides a garage door and belt connecting buckle, which comprises a mounting main body 1, a buckle piece 2, a fixed plate 3, a push plate 4, a clamping rod 5 and a clamping hook 6; the installation main body 1 is fixedly installed on the garage roof, a belt is installed in the installation main body 1, a motor box 101 is clamped at the bottom of the installation main body 1, a driving motor is installed in the motor box 101, and a driving shaft of the driving motor is coaxially connected to the belt; the front side of the buckling piece 2 is provided with a barb 201, the inside of the buckling piece 2 and the inside of the tail end of the barb 201 are fixedly provided with a connecting rod 202, and the left side of the buckling piece 2 is hooked with a hook 6 at the top end of the garage door; front clamping blocks 203 at the upper and lower ends of the connecting rod 202; the fixed plate 3 is fixedly inserted in the front side of the buckle piece 2; the push plate 4 is movably clamped at the rear side of the fixed plate 3 and the front side of the clamping piece 2; the clamping rod 5 is longitudinally inserted into the clamping piece 2.
As shown in fig. 2, fig. 5 and fig. 6, the left end of the fastener 2 is provided with a hook plate 204, the hook plate 204 is buckled on a hook 6 at the top end of the garage door, the front side plate of the hook plate 204 is propped against the rear end surface of the hook 6, the clamping block 203 is a wedge-shaped structure block, the lengths of three groups of barbs 201 at the left, middle and right positions inside the fastener 2 are greater than those of other groups of barbs 201, a circular jack is arranged inside the fastener 2, after a belt passes through the inside of the fastener 2, the belt is locked through the barbs 201, the three groups of barbs 201 at the left, middle and right positions strengthen the clamping locking with the belt, after the belt is driven to rotate by a driving motor, the fastener 2 is driven to move, and the hook 6 at the top end of the garage door is further driven to move, so that the garage door can be lifted.
As shown in fig. 6, the clamping rod 5 is inserted into the circular insertion holes in the clamping piece 2 and the insertion block 301 in a longitudinal interference fit manner, and the clamping piece 2 and the fixing plate 3 are inserted into the clamping rod 5, so that the position of the fixing plate 3 can be fixed, the push plate 4 can only move directionally in the left-right direction, and meanwhile, one ends of the spring and the telescopic sleeve are limited, and the push plate 4 can be reset.
As shown in fig. 4, the upper end surface and the lower end surface of the left, middle and three positions of the push plate 4 are respectively and fixedly provided with a push block 401, the push block 401 is in a wedge-shaped structure, the inclined surface is attached to the inclined surface of the clamping block 203, the front end surface of the push plate 4 is fixedly provided with a pull plate 403, when the pull plate 403 is pulled, the push plate 4 is driven to slide at the rear side of the fixed plate 3, meanwhile, a spring and a telescopic sleeve are compressed, after the connection position between the clamping piece 2 and a belt is completed, the push plate 4 is released, the push plate 4 is pushed by the spring to reset, the push block 401 is also pushed to be separated from the constraint force of the clamping block 203, and the barb 201 is automatically reset under the elastic action to complete the clamping connection with the belt.
As shown in fig. 4, the upper and lower sides of the rear end of the fixing plate 3 are provided with an insert 301, the insert 301 is inserted into the fastener 2, the interior of the insert 301 is provided with a longitudinal circular jack, the left side surface of the fixing plate 3 is fixedly provided with a spring and a telescopic tube, the left end of the spring and the telescopic tube is fixedly connected with a retaining plate 302, the left end surface of the retaining plate 302 is attached to the right end surface of the clamping block 203, the fixing plate 3 can be inserted into the fastener 2 by the insert 301, the clamping rod 5 can penetrate through and fixedly connect the fixing plate 3 with the fastener 2 by the longitudinal circular jack in the insert 301, the assembly is completed, after the push block 401 pushes the clamping block 203 to move, three groups of barbs 201 at the left, middle and right positions are taken out by the connecting rod 202, so that the clamping position between a belt and the fastener 2 can be conveniently adjusted, and the lifting opening and closing initial position of the garage door can be adjusted.
As shown in fig. 1 and fig. 2, a clamping piece 102 is arranged in the installation main body 1, a rectangular groove is formed in the right side of the clamping piece 102, a top rectangular plate of a motor box 101 is clamped in the rectangular groove, the motor box 101 is clamped at the bottom of the installation main body 1, then slides rightward to enable the right rectangular plate at the top of the motor box 101 to be clamped in the installation main body 1, the clamping piece 102 is pushed backwards to be clamped in the installation main body 1, and at the moment, the rectangular plate at the left side of the top of the motor box 101 is inserted into the rectangular groove in the clamping piece 102, so that the fixed clamping between the motor box 101 and the installation main body 1 is completed, and the disassembly and the overhaul are convenient.
Specific use and action of the embodiment:
in the utility model, after a belt passes through the inside of a buckling piece 2, the belt is locked through barbs 201, three groups of barbs 201 at the left, middle and right are reinforced and locked with the belt, a pull plate 403 is pulled to drive a push plate 4 to slide at the rear side of a fixed plate 3, a spring and a telescopic sleeve are compressed at the same time, a push block 401 pushes a clamping block 203 to move, and then the three groups of barbs 201 at the left, middle and right are brought out through a connecting rod 202, so that the clamping position between the belt and the buckling piece 2 is conveniently adjusted, the lifting opening and closing initial position of a garage door is adjusted, the push plate 4 is released, the push plate 4 is pushed by the spring to reset, the push block 401 is also pushed to break away from the constraint force of the clamping block 203, and the barbs 201 are automatically reset under the elastic action to finish the clamping with the belt;
when the belt is driven to rotate by the driving motor, the clamping piece 2 is driven to move, and the clamping hook 6 at the top end of the garage door is further driven to move, so that the garage door can be lifted.
